Professional Geologist

About the Role:
Arch Environmental Group, Inc. (AEG) is seeking a licensed Professional Geologist to join our cleanWATER Team. This individual will provide technical leadership for environmental assessment and remediation projects across Michigan and neighboring states. You’ll play a key role in supporting site investigations, developing regulatory reports, and mentoring team members, while ensuring safety, compliance, and efficiency in both office and field environments.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and manage environmental site assessments (Phase I/II, LUST, Oil Extraction, etc.).
  • Perform field investigations and develop geological logs and site surveys.
  • Analyze soil, sediment, and groundwater samples and prepare regulatory reports.
  • Support development of remedial action plans and oversee field implementation.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ams and manage subcontractor activities.
  • Prepare proposals, scopes of work, schedules, and budgets.
  • Ensure adherence to state, local, and federal environmental regulations.
  • Participate in safety meetings and professional development sessions.
  • Provide mentorship to junior staff and foster a strong team environment.
Qualifications:

  • Licensed Professional Geologist (CPG preferred); AIPG certification a plus.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Geology, Engineering, or a related field (Master’s preferred).
  • Minimum 8 years of relevant environmental field and project management experience.
  • OSHA 40-hour HAZWOPER certification required.
  • Familiarity with federal/state environmental laws and permitting.
  • Advanced skills in MS Word and Excel; GIS experience a plus.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Must be authorized to work in the U.S. (no visa sponsorship available).
Position Requirements:

  • Must pass a medical screening (including drug testing and respirator fit test).
  • Travel up to 25%, including fieldwork in varied weather conditions.
  • Personal vehicle required for project-related travel (reimbursable mileage).
  • Must be able to lift 25 pounds.

Flexible work from home options available.

Compensation: $80,000.00 - $90,000.00 per year
